Why windows 10 start menu not working?

If the Windows 10 start menu not working problem is related to system bugs or defects, then you can fix the problem by upgrading your system to the latest version. Microsoft is constantly improving its Windows 10 operating system, so keeping your system up to date is a good idea.

Many problems occurred randomly on your computer can be solved simply by a restart. So you should try to fix Start menu won’t open Windows 10 by restarting the PC first. Shut down the computer. Wait for a few minutes. Power on the computer again and try to open Start menu. If this failed, you can try to initiate a full shutdown.

I can dig a little deeper. if one or more of the temporary files used in the Start menu are corrupt, missing, or out of date, your Start menu may collapse or freeze. This can be fixed by restoring the files. In some cases, Cortana files may become corrupt or damaged. If you have the feature turned on, it’s possible that it may crash your Start menu. How to windows 10 start menu?

Windows 10 To open the Start menu—which contains all your apps, settings, and files—do either of the following: On the left end of the taskbar, select the Start icon. Press the Windows logo key on your keyboard.

How to fix Windows Explorer not working on Windows 10?

Scroll through the list until you find the “Windows Explorer” process. Then right click on “Windows Explorer” and select “Restart”: There will be a brief flash while Windows restarts Windows Explorer/Finder, along with the taskbar and Start Menu. After that, try to open the Start Menu.
